您好,欢迎您来到国盈网!
官网首页 小额贷款 购房贷款 抵押贷款 银行贷款 贷款平台 贷款知识 区块链

国盈网 > 区块链 > 闪电网络节点教程,闪电网络原理

闪电网络节点教程,闪电网络原理

区块链 岑岑 本站原创

Twitter创始人JackDorsey创立的比特币技术团队Spiral开发的LDK(Lightning Development Kit)最近向公众解释了未来一年的新路线图,涵盖了LDK的全景发展。

2023年是比特币进取的一年,不仅在NFT领域捷报频传,在二线网络和智能合约方面也有所斩获。例如,序数和栈等项目正在逐步释放比特币的更多用途。

使用量的增加自然会促进生态繁荣。自2021年Taproot升级以来,保守稳健的比特币社区短期内不可能扩大本体。闪电网几乎是提高网络效率和用户体验的唯一选择。

在此次路线图更新中,值得注意的改进包括两点:

短期:LDK节点移动,将基于LDK实现LN钱包和节点,包括更多模块化的设计思路,方便节点的开发和对接;长期:异步支付,目前的闪电网需要交易双方同时在线才能完成交易,异步支付可以用在收单方离线的场景。

解读闪电网络LDK新功能:更便捷的节点设置和异步支付的设想

节点的短期优化,比特币的长期异步支付,闪电网的一系列开发和推广,都离不开Twitter创始人杰克·多西。在他的设想中,比特币将是未来经济体系的基石,通过闪电网络释放比特币的潜力,让全世界的用户都可以参与进来。

具体来说,更新的LDK是杰克·多西创立的Block公司赞助的螺旋开发项目的一部分。螺旋由LDK、BDK(比特币开发工具包)和比特币设计社区三部分组成,统一了服务比特币生态的完整要素。

LDK用于满足开发者的开发需求,BDK用于降低比特币开发难度,比特币设计社区用于满足用户对UI、设计、交互的体验。

解读闪电网络LDK新功能:更便捷的节点设置和异步支付的设想

2021年12月,螺旋第一次发布了LDK。从项目一开始就以开发者服务为主,主要通过在闪电网上进行二次开发,打包成一个完整的闪电网项目库。开发者可以直接使用LDK构建闪电网络节点,避免了与闪电网络和比特币网络直接交互的复杂性。

LDK的主要用户是Block公司旗下的Cash App。通过将LDK集成到现金App中,实现了对比特币闪电网的支持。目前,现金App已经支持直接将存款转入比特币、接受和发送比特币等操作。,这初步证明了LDK闪电网络的能力。

另一方面,基于比特币闪电网,Web 3的社交协议Damus也支持比特币打赏、转账等相关功能,更进一步,可以构建“Web 5 & # 8243Web 3的当前社会和金融协议被总结成一个统一的整体。

详情请参考上一篇文章:Twitter陷入了“马嘴”。前掌门人杰克·多西的Web 5怎么样?

比特币闪电网络已经初步形成,包括* *、BTC锁定金额和生态支持,LDK已经被40多个应用采用。

目前,闪电网的进一步发展主要受到两方面的限制:一是开发者设置仍不方便,LDK本身不提供节点服务,开发者需要定制设置以满足不同需求;其次,在用户体验上还是有一些提升的,比如隐私服务和反审查能力,以及异步支付带来的网络到达率问题。

在这次路线图更新中,2023年的Q2将专注于LDK节点移动,然后在2024年继续到Q1,这将主要专注于解决异步支付问题。不难看出,异步支付将是一块更难啃的骨头,因为它将直接为消费者提供功能性服务,开发团队需要采取更加谨慎的态度。

LDK节点移动:优化节点配置。在这次更新中,LDK节点移动被放在第一位。LDK提供了一系列强大的API,给予开发者更大的控制权。LDK节点本身提供了一个全功能的闪电网络节点/钱包。该节点是闪电网络最重要的部分,BTC将通过该节点进行发送和接收。有关闪电网络的更多信息,请参考上一篇文章:

LDK节点移动将是一个基于BDK的链钱包,可用于链块的数据集成、本地数据存储以及闪电网络和其他钱包状态的云备份服务。LDK现有的900多个函数方法可以压缩到15个左右,最终目标是让开发者在一天内搭建一个节点。

此外,得益于API功能的丰富,LDK允许开发者进行更加定制化的开发。在最初的版本中,LDK对Rust的语言支持更加友好。在这一轮更新中,将逐步纳入Java/Swift/Python/Flutter/React等语言和框架,以鼓励开发者开发更多可以在设备上运行的lightning网络节点和应用。

解读闪电网络LDK新功能:更便捷的节点设置和异步支付的设想

异步支付:闪电网普及的最后一步是异步支付,即收、发双方无需同时在线,可以按照传统金融的转账逻辑进行操作。但目前闪电网的移动用户需要对方在线才能收款,否则交易会受到失败的困扰。

LDK开发者在2021年进行了预研,但在此次路线图更新中,异步支付被视为今年下半年的重点项目,并努力从技术层面解决这一问题,实现与传统支付方式相同的支付体验。

根据路线图,2023年Q3开始预研,可能要到Q4才能真正进入开发阶段。为了保证安全,异步支付功能的开发将分为两个阶段,第一步首先完成异步受理,第二步完善异步传输。

异步接收功能相对简单。任何钱包都有其托管节点。为了保证运行的稳定性,节点会保持与闪电网的链接,然后节点上线时会存储在移动端口(手机、外挂钱包)。

异步传输相对困难,需要通过移动端口发送。这部分将在发展中逐步探索更好的解决方案。

解读闪电网络LDK新功能:更便捷的节点设置和异步支付的设想

本次路线图更新中的其他功能,也有一些实现难度较小的功能更新,比较典型的如下:

BOLT 12提供闪电网原生二维码应用支付服务。用户可以扫描二维码进行支付,并且可以重复使用。同时使用了洋葱网络、Schnorr签名、Merkel树、盲路径、支付者证明等加密技术。您可以在保持匿名的情况下完成支付、生成支付证书和申请退款。

VSS(版本化存储服务)VSS(版本化存储服务)可以解决两个问题。首先,它为闪电网络的节点状态和钱包数据提供云备份服务。如果手机等终端丢失或无法使用,可以使用VSS进行资产回收。其次,VSS可以支持同一个钱包中多个设备的同时登录和状态同步,使钱包和节点数据始终保持一致。

简单的直根通道(LDK)将与比特币主网的直根升级功能保持一致,比如多签功能的同步,以保持与主网相同的安全性。随着LDK的进一步发展,将会逐渐兼容更多的直根功能。

结论在此次LDK路线图更新中,我们可以看到闪电网络正在进入面向用户发展的新阶段。随着比特币生态的进一步发展,特别是对NFT、流支付和社交产品的更多支持,闪电网有望迎来真正的繁荣期。

本网站声明:网站内容来源于网络。如有侵权,请联系我们,我们会及时处理。

温馨提示:注:内容来源均采集于互联网,不要轻信任何,后果自负,本站不承担任何责任。若本站收录的信息无意侵犯了贵司版权,请给我们来信(j7hr0a@163.com),我们会及时处理和回复。

原文地址"闪电网络节点教程,闪电网络原理":http://www.guoyinggangguan.com/qkl/161641.html

微信扫描二维码关注官方微信
▲长按图片识别二维码